Full Description

Handbook of Diversity in Body Image offers a groundbreaking perspective that moves beyond conventional body image discussions. This volume explores how body image is shaped and experienced across different cultures, tracing the development of research and practical approaches from historical viewpoints to contemporary understandings. By examining diverse cultural contexts and integrating voices that have often been overlooked, the book fosters a more inclusive, nuanced comprehension of body image. Its approach encourages readers to recognize the complexities and varied influences that contribute to individual and collective perceptions of bodies around the world.

In addition to its global scope, the book provides thorough analyses of body image issues in specific populations, including racialized minority groups, LGBTQ+ communities, men, those experiencing food insecurity, and individuals from various religious backgrounds. Each chapter underscores the crucial role of intersectionality, highlighting how overlapping identities affect body image experiences.
